On October 18, 2023, I stepped into a WordPress Meetup at Humber Polytechnic, unaware that it would lead me to the connection I needed to land my co-op position for the summer. Regina Azevedo (LinkedIn) delivered an inspiring presentation that introduced me to the exciting world of data analytics at Publicis Groupe, discussing topics such as digital and social analytics and search engine optimization (SEO).
Regina’s enthusiasm for uncovering data-driven insights motivated me to approach her after the presentation. Although there weren’t any co-op opportunities available at that moment, she graciously invited me to connect on LinkedIn to keep in touch regarding future openings. I was so inspired by her talk that months later I reached out to her, and to my delight, I learned about a co-op position that had recently become available. I applied, interviewed, and was thrilled to be offered a role as a Junior Data Analyst for the summer of 2024.
As I embarked on my journey with the Publicis co-op program, I never anticipated how quickly four months would fly by. Throughout my rotations, I engaged in a diverse range of activities that included developing social media and web reports, conducting client survey research, creating dashboards and visualizations in Excel and Looker, and performing in-depth keyword research. I cherished every moment—from the incredible people and workplace culture to the enriching learning experiences. Publicis provided me with the ideal co-op that only reaffirmed my desired career path.
